Regional Wikimedia AmbassadorYork Museums Trust Jul 2014 - Jul 2015York, United KingdomThis role was created for me as a unique continuation of the Wikipedian-in-Residence programme. I expanded the collaboration across the whole county by working with the Museums Development service.This was part of a global initiative (GLAMwiki) helping galleries, libraries, archives and museums to work with Wikipedia, thus joining publicly/charitably funded knowledge repositories with the world’s 7th-most-popular website. I was tasked with negotiating relationships between the museums - from the National Media Museum to rural village-hall museums - and the Wikimedia community.I ran promotional talks and training workshops for museum professionals, volunteers and university students and worked with curators to develop strategies for opening up their collections and knowledge. -
Wikipedian In ResidenceYork Museums Trust Oct 2013 - Apr 2014York, United KingdomA Wikipedian-in-Residence works with institutions (normally galleries, libraries, archives or museums) to help them build relationships with Wikipedia and its sister projects. I worked to help York Museums Trust (YMT) share its digital collections, train staff and volunteers, and work with the Wikipedia community.I was also involved in the development of digitisation strategies. My contributions have aided in the development of YMT’s new public, online collection. -
